Ingredients You'll Need

Here's what you're working with:

  • ¼ cup butter (the real stuff we're not playing around here)
  • 3 stalks celery, diced (that satisfying crunch factor)
  • 1 small onion, diced
  • ¼ cup all-purpose flour (our thickening agent)
  • ¾ cup half-and-half cream
  • 3 cups water
  • 1 cube chicken bouillon
  • 2 cups cubed cooked chicken (rotisserie chicken is your friend)
  • 1½ cups shredded Cheddar cheese (sharp works beautifully)
  • ¼ cup Buffalo wing sauce (or more if you like to live dangerously)
  • Salt and pepper to taste

The ingredient list might look basic, but that's the beauty of it. Most of this is probably already in your kitchen right now.

How to Make Buffalo Chicken Soup

Let's get cooking. This is so straightforward that even my teenage nephew managed it without texting me for help.

Step 1: Grab your largest pot and melt that butter over medium-high heat. Once it's sizzling, toss in your diced celery and onion. Let them cook for about 5 minutes until they're tender and your kitchen starts smelling amazing. This is when my dog usually appears, looking hopeful.

Step 2: Sprinkle in the flour and stir it around for about 2 minutes. It'll look a bit paste-like that's exactly what you want. This step is what gives your soup that luscious, thick texture instead of watery sadness.

Step 3: Now comes the fun part. Slowly pour in the half-and-half and water, stirring as you go. Think of it like you're coaxing everything together into one happy family. Drop in that bouillon cube and keep stirring until it dissolves completely.

Step 4: Add your chicken, Cheddar cheese, and Buffalo sauce. Season with salt and pepper. Here's where you can taste and adjust want more heat? Add more sauce. Prefer it milder? Keep it as is.

Step 5: Turn the heat down to medium-low and let everything simmer for about 10 minutes, stirring occasionally. The cheese needs to melt completely and all those flavors need to get acquainted. You'll know it's ready when the soup is silky and everything's melted together beautifully.

Making It Your Own

Buffalo Chicken Soup Keto Style

Going low-carb? Swap the flour for xanthan gum (just a teaspoon will do) or skip the thickener entirely. Use heavy cream instead of half-and-half, and you're golden. The easy keto chicken salad recipe uses similar techniques if you want more keto-friendly ideas.

Creamy Buffalo Chicken Soup Variations

Want it extra creamy? Add a brick of easy buffalo chicken dip recipe cream cheese when you stir in the Cheddar. It makes the soup ridiculously rich and silky. You can also try it with chicken broccoli pasta techniques for added texture.

Buffalo Chicken Soup Slow Cooker Method

Honestly, the slow cooker version is perfect for those mornings when you know dinner needs to be ready the second you walk in the door. Toss everything except the cheese and cream into your slow cooker. Cook on low for 6 hours or high for 3 hours. About 30 minutes before serving, stir in the cheese and cream. It's that simple. Storage and Reheating Tips

Good news: this soup actually tastes better the next day. The flavors meld together overnight in a magical way. Store it in an airtight container in the fridge for up to 4 days.

When reheating, do it gently over low heat on the stovetop, stirring occasionally. The microwave works in a pinch, but go in 30-second intervals to prevent the cheese from separating. If it's too thick after refrigeration, thin it out with a splash of milk or broth.

Can you freeze it? Yes, but the texture might get a bit grainy when you reheat it because of the dairy. If you're planning to freeze it, make the base without the cream and cheese, then add those fresh when you reheat.

Tips from My Kitchen to Yours

After making this soup more times than I can count, here's what I've learned:

  • Don't skip the flour step it's what prevents your soup from being watery
  • Let the cheese come to room temperature before adding it (melts way smoother)
  • Taste as you go, especially with the Buffalo sauce (heat levels vary wildly between brands)
  • If it gets too spicy, a dollop of sour cream on top helps calm things down
  • Fresh celery gives better texture than frozen
  • Day-old soup tastes even better than fresh (if you can wait)

Description

A creamy, tangy, spicy Buffalo chicken soup that comes together in about 20 minutes. Comforting, flavorful, and perfect for busy weeknights.


Ingredients

Scale
  • ¼ cup butter
  • 3 stalks celery, diced
  • 1 small onion, diced
  • ¼ cup all-purpose flour
  • ¾ cup half-and-half cream
  • 3 cups water
  • 1 chicken bouillon cube
  • 2 cups cubed cooked chicken
  • 1 ½ cups shredded Cheddar cheese
  • ¼ cup Buffalo wing sauce
  • Salt and pepper to taste


Instructions

  1. Melt butter in a large pot over medium-high heat. Add celery and onion and cook for about 5 minutes until tender.
  2. Sprinkle in flour and cook for 2 minutes, stirring to form a paste.
  3. Slowly pour in half-and-half and water, stirring constantly. Add bouillon cube and stir until dissolved.
  4. Add chicken, Cheddar cheese, and Buffalo sauce. Season with salt and pepper and adjust heat level as desired.
  5. Reduce heat to medium-low and simmer for 10 minutes, stirring occasionally, until smooth and creamy.

Notes

Store in the fridge for up to 4 days. Reheat gently to prevent cheese separation. For freezing, omit dairy until reheating.
